Peptide research brief BPC-157: mechanism, in vitro studies, and gaps in human evidence Common name BPC-157 Classification Synthetic peptide fragment (gastric pentadecapeptide) Sequence GEPPPGKPADDAGLV Molecular formula C62H98N16O22 Molecular weight 1419.55 Da CAS 137525-51-0 BPC-157: mechanism, in vitro studies, and gaps in human evidence The proposed bpc-157 mechanism of action centers on a pro-angiogenic signaling cascade reported across rodent and cell-culture experiments, with VEGFR2 receptor activation and downstream endothelial nitric oxide synthase (eNOS) phosphorylation as the most frequently cited nodes (Hsieh et al., 2017
